Can a "top" first class like LaPremière still be improved? The answer is yes, word of Air France. After years in which first class had already achieved levels of excellence, the French airline decided to go further by introducing a revamped, more spacious, more intimate cabin.

In this article:

    AF unveiled the booth last March-we at TFC were there, ed. - And now, gradually, More and more routes feature the 'new' LaPremiere: let's find out.

    A very exclusive cabin: it is only available on a few(s) Boeing 777-300ERs

    Première remains one of the most exclusive products in commercial aviation, is factual.

    It is only available on a portion of the fleet Boeing 777-300ER, the only planes the French-Dutch airline has configured with four classes: first, business, premium economy and economy. Currently only in six planes (brands F-GSQE, F-GZND, F-GZNK, F-GZNP, F-GZNQ and F-GSQK) was installed the new suite. The goal is to complete the retrofit of all four-cabin 777s by the end of the 2026, at a rate of one plane per month.

    La Première's routes (and where the new cabin flies)

    Flying aboard La Premiere is not at all easy. Costs aside-which, later, we will discuss-the difficulty lies in the fact that the routes are limited; in addition to this, the cabin has only four places. From theParis-Charles de Gaulle airport - the "home" of Air France, you can fly aboard La Premiere to New York (JFK), Los Angeles, Miami, San Francisco, Singapore, Tokyo (HND), Dubai, San Paul, Abidjan, Washington. From December 15, 2025, then, also Tel Aviv (TLV) will become part of La Première routes (but for the time being will only be available during during the winter season until the March 28, 2026).

    As for the new LaPremiere, however, the routes served are still few.

    It is available on flights from Paris to New York (flights AF3/4 and AF5/6), from Paris to Singapore (flights AF256/257), and from Paris to Los Angeles (AF22/23 flights). From November 10, 2025 next, also the route Paris - Miami (MIA) (flights AF90/91) will be operated with the new product, while in December it will be the turn of Tokyo Haneda (HND).

    How to tell if you're flying with the new La Première

    On the Air France website, it only takes a small detail to find out: if you see the words "aircraft equipped with the new La Première suite.", then you are in the right place (in fact, the best place).

    Also the map of places helps: the new configuration shows a armchair and a chaise longue in each suite, with numbering 1A, 1D, 1H and 1L; the old version, on the other hand, had 1A, 1E, 1F and 1L.

    How much does it cost to fly La Première

    We say it now: is not for everyone, and not only for the cost Of the ticket which, in money, exceeds the 10,000 each way. Even redeeming an award ticket to fly aboard Air France's exclusive first class is beyond the reach of all passengers: nn it is not enough, trivially, to have a big pile of miles.

    The reason? Well, because Air France only allows holders of the Platinum status of Flying Blue to detach an award ticket to fly in this cabin. That's not all: you can no longer even upgrade to LP if an award ticket in business class has been redeemed.
